Top 3 responsibilities
Analyze system requirements and translate into detailed test specifications and cases; define acceptance criteria for new releases
Execute manual and automated tests on benches; ensure correct test environment setup (wiring, loads, simulation nodes)
Analyze bus traffic (CAN/LIN/Automotive Ethernet), perform root-cause analysis of failures, document defects with logs, reproduce fixes; maintain and enhance test scripts; optionally integrate into CI/CD
Must-have skills
Advanced Python, CAPL; Vector CANoe/CANalyzer; Intland CodeBeamer
Advanced CAN/LIN/Automotive Ethernet knowledge and UDS
2β3 yearsβ embedded/test validation experience
Professional-level English
Ability to document results precisely and communicate defects
Nice-to-haves
Experience with CI/CD tools (Jenkins, GitLab) and test automation integration
Familiarity with DOORS/vTestStudio; strong scripting in Python/C#
